Job Description
We’re hiring a Regional Sales & Brand Development Lead to help build Brakebee’s national, in-person sales organization from the ground up, starting in the Phoenix region.
This role is intentionally designed to start hands-on in the field , while being based out of our Phoenix office from day one. You will sell directly at events, develop wholesale relationships, and work closely with leadership to learn the market, refine strategy, and prove what works. This phase is foundational — it’s how you gain the insight and credibility needed to design systems and lead a team effectively.
As traction builds, your role evolves. You’ll gradually shift from personal selling into system design, supervision, and team-building : documenting workflows, hiring and training reps, and transitioning personal accounts into repeatable team-led processes. Over time, this role grows into department leadership , focused on strategy, performance, and scaling the model across new territories.
This is an entrepreneurial opportunity for someone who wants to build the machine, then lead it — not manage from the sidelines.

Why This Role Matters
This is not a traditional sales job. You’ll help define how Brakebee grows in new markets, shape a national in-person sales strategy, and build the systems and teams that power long-term expansion. If you’re driven, adaptable, and excited by the idea of building something real from the ground up, this role offers ownership, visibility, and meaningful upside.
Company DescriptionBrakebee is the OS powering the everyday art community — online and off. We design and represent in-house art and gourmet brands, operate retail and gallery concepts, and connect artists, festivals, and retailers through one integrated creative platform. From pop-up events to wholesale and national distribution, we build the infrastructure behind how art is made, sold, and scaled.
